Transaction 153b79ebcd089ee88558052307dc3dd2952c0a5afca53f11c8e3cc1c7c5c379d

1 Input
2 Outputs
  • 153b79ebcd089ee88558052307dc3dd2952c0a5afca53f11c8e3cc1c7c5c379d:0
  • value  600000000
    address  38z4Cm6Bh5JYQGUuKzpdStsfFpg36Zd1V4
  • 153b79ebcd089ee88558052307dc3dd2952c0a5afca53f11c8e3cc1c7c5c379d:1
  • value  5740668724
    address  39aRmARnAhEBvsvBghkHNv9YB6yeKwdTQA